Chuckles: The Imaginary Squirrel
A little girl named Amanda lived with her parents in a small town. Everyone knew Amanda for her vibrant green eyes, shimmering red hair, and a contagious smile. However, she held a secret that only a few were privileged to know - she had an imaginary friend - a little squirrel named Chuckles.
Chuckles was more than just an imaginary friend. He was a great supporter, a confidant, a motivator and sometimes, a mischievous companion for Amanda. He lived in the giant oak tree outside Amanda’s house and spent all his day accompanying her in her ventures.
Days turned into weeks, weeks into months, and soon, Amanda and Chuckles were inseparable. They attended school together, did homework, shared lunch, stories, dreams, and fears. Chuckles was an essential part of Amanda’s life. Yet, it was only one-sided. While Amanda’s life was bright with Chuckle's presence, he was but a product of her imagination.
One day, Amanda's creativity reached a whole new level. She began to illustrate stories featuring herself and Chuckles as the protagonists. Her vivid imagination and sharp narration attracted the teachers' attention, and soon, her stories became a regular feature in the school magazine.
Meanwhile, Chuckles, through Amanda's stories, was no longer confined to her world. The school started acknowledging him, and gradually, the entire town knew about the little squirrel named Chuckles, his adventures, his wisdom, his courage, and his loyalty.
One day, a renowned publisher from the city, Mr. Grayson, visited the small town for work. Upon hearing the tales of Amanda and Chuckles, he was intrigued and decided to meet this little girl whose stories were a local sensation.
An appointment was arranged, and Grayson found himself astounded by Amanda's creativity. With parental permission, he proposed a contract to publish Amanda's stories into a children's book. Thrilled by the opportunity, Amanda agreed. She spent the entire summer weaving new tales of her and Chuckles, which were beautifully illustrated to add visual charm.
Her book, named 'Chuckles: The Imaginary Squirrel and His Mighty Adventures,' was finally published and much to everyone's delight, turned into a major success. Kids loved the adventures of Chuckles and longed for more. Amanda, overwhelmed with the response, promised to continue creating fascinating stories about her imaginary friend.
As the years passed, Amanda grew, and so did her friendship with Chuckles. She ventured to college in the city, but Chuckles remained in the small town, waiting for her return. However, the distance couldn’t separate them; Amanda took him along through her books. She continued creating stories that were cherished by readers globally. Chuckles, the once imaginary squirrel, became a household name.
Years later, Amanda returned to her town. She was now a renowned author known for her series of 'Chuckles' books. Upon her arrival, she visited the old oak tree, the birthplace of Chuckles. She found an old, worn-out Chuckles plushie under the tree, one she made when she was a kid. Holding it in her hands, she remembered her childhood, her friend Chuckles, who was still there with her, through her writings. Bounded by the power of imagination, Chuckles was now not just a figment of her thoughts, but a character loved by all.
The story of Amanda is a beautiful reminder of the strength of imagination and the magic it can create. Her journey established the concept that you are never alone when you have your imagination to entertain you, guide you, and create wonders. It tells us that wonderful things can happen when you believe in the power of your dreams and your creativity, even if it seems as imaginary as a friend named Chuckles.
And Chuckles, though imaginary, will always be remembered as the squirrel who inspired a humble town girl to become a globally renowned author. The tale of Amanda and Chuckles is a testament to the beautiful bond between a girl and her imaginary friend. The friendship will forever be celebrated through the timeless stories they shared.
